Key Cost Influences

Residential siding installation in Johnson County, TX, involves selecting appropriate materials and ensuring proper scope to enhance a home's exterior. Understanding typical project components can help homeowners compare options and plan accordingly.

  • Materials: Common siding options include vinyl, fiber cement, wood, and aluminum, each offering different durability and appearance.
  • Size and Scope: Projects vary from small repairs to full exterior replacements, depending on the home's size and existing siding condition.
  • Labor Complexity: Installation complexity depends on siding type, existing wall conditions, and the home's architectural features.
  • Permitting: Local regulations in Johnson County may require permits for complete siding replacements or significant modifications.
  • Additional Features: Options such as insulation, decorative accents, or weatherproofing may be included or added as extras during installation.

Project Size Considerations

Residential siding installation projects in Johnson County, TX, typically vary based on the size of the home and the type of siding material selected. Understanding the scope and associated costs can help homeowners plan and compare options effectively.

Scope/Size Typical Range
Small home (1,000-1,500 sq ft) $5,000 - $10,000
Medium home (1,500-2,500 sq ft) $10,000 - $20,000
Large home (2,500+ sq ft) $20,000 - $40,000
Siding material (vinyl, fiber cement, wood) Varies by material, $3 - $10 per sq ft

In Johnson County, TX, project costs can fluctuate based on home size, siding material, and local labor rates, so obtaining multiple quotes is recommended for accurate budgeting.
